## Step 4 — Deploy the order-cutoff rule

Welcome aboard! This step pushes the Crumbhaven cutoff rule: orders placed after 2 p.m. roll to the next bake day. Double-check the timezone config first — the ovens run on Pellworth local time, not UTC. Once the config looks good, sign the deploy bundle with the key just below.

release key, tajep-tahaf: bky19_d9NV5NtNvNNQVVKBK4P

Subject: Turnstile counter cut-over complete

Team, the Gatewick stadium counter moved to the new Tallyline service last night. All forty turnstiles now report through the central aggregator, and the legacy poller is retired. Counts matched within 0.1% during the parallel run. For reference while you onboard, the production aggregator runs with the following configuration.

service settings:
PRAWYN_PIN=9848
PRAWYN_METRICS_HOST=metrics.prawyn.lumicworks.corp
PRAWYN_LOG_LEVEL=warn
PRAWYN_TENANT=pelius

// Support folks: this constant caps batch size for the Fernwhistle
// GraphQL resolver. We used to fire one query per comment author
// (classic N+1), which is why ticket spikes lined up with big threads
// on Pellgrove workspaces. Now we batch-load authors in chunks of this
// size, so if someone reports slow thread loads, check whether they're
// somehow on a build older than the fix. Don't bump this past 200
// without pinging the data team first. The fixed build's trace token
// is recorded on the line below.

build token for yajof-bajof: htk31_506ff1188f74596b5bb2eec94edc43c